Key-Date 1883-CC Morgan Silver Dollar

No United States Branch Mint has a greater connection to the Morgan Silver Dollar than Carson City. After all, the Carson City Mint was established specifically to strike the vast quantity of silver being mined from the Comstock Lode, the greatest source of silver ever discovered in the United States! Rather than haul all the silver east to the Philadelphia Mint or transport it across the mountains to the San Francisco Mint on the West Coast, the Carson City Mint was constructed near the base of the Sierra Nevada Mountains. Wild West Morgans From The Carson City Mint

These coins were the workhorses of the American Wild West, struck from silver mined from Nevada’s famous Comstock Lode. The Carson City Mint is the mint responsible for the smallest number of Morgans struck. Coins like these would have traveled in the saddlebags and pockets of cowboys, soldiers, gunfighters and settlers all across America’s Wild West.

  • AMERICA’S MOST POPULAR AND COLLECTED COIN – Designed by U.S. Mint Engraver George T. Morgan, the Morgan Silver Dollar was struck from 1878 to 1904 and again in 1921. Today it is one of the most popular and heavily collected of all United States coins.
  • KEY DATE MORGAN SILVER DOLLAR– Your 1883-CC Morgan Silver Dollar was struck at the Carson City Mint. Morgans bearing the “CC” mint mark are valued by collectors because the Carson City Mint is the mint responsible for the smallest number of Morgans struck.
  • STRUCK IN FINE AMERICAN SILVER – Morgan Silver Dollars were struck in 26.73 grams of highly pure 90%fine silver mined from the famous Comstock Lode in Nevada.
  • LEGAL TENDER AMERICAN COINAGE – Each Morgan Silver Dollar was one dollar legal tender.
  • GEM UNCIRCULATED CONDITION – Your 1883-CC Morgan Silver Dollar comes certified and graded by the Professional Coin Grading Service (PCGS) in Gem Uncirculated Mint State-65 (MS65) condition.
  • THE CASE OF THE DISAPPEARING MORGAN – Despite millions of Morgan Silver Dollars being struck from 1878-1921, most were lost in circulation or melted down in mass silver meltings. In fact, coin experts believe that only 15% of all Morgan ever struck remain in existence today.
